sharefine/furgaclient/www/js/spesefurga.js
2016-08-26 17:54:18 +02:00

117 lines
No EOL
2.3 KiB
JavaScript

var prog_name=[];
var prog_data=[];
var prog_indice=0;
var sbollo=100;
var sassicurazione=600;
var deposito=600;
var totale=sbollo+sassicurazione+deposito;
console.log(totale+ "totale");
var user=["gabri", "ge", "brogie", "col_G"];
var giorni_uso=[23, 14, 200, 12];
//se lo si usa come collettivo vale 1 o vale 4?!
var s_giorni_uso=0;
var days=[23,23,23,23];
var n_user=user.length;
console.log(user.length+" utenti");
var p_annuale=(totale/n_user);
var p_giornaliero=p_annuale/365;
var full_giornaliero = totale/365;
var giorni_comuni=365;
var q_giorni_comuni=p_giornaliero*giorni_comuni;
var quote=[];
console.log(p_giornaliero+" piano giornaliera a capa");
console.log(p_annuale+" piano annuale a capa, "+(365/n_user)+" giorni");
function sommatoria(array_x){
var variabile=0;
for(var i=0;i<array_x.length;i=i+1){
variabile += array_x[i];
}
return variabile;
//attenzione non è universale! ma non so come assegnare quella variabile a s_giorni_uso come argomento. rimane sempre zero.why?
// console.log(variabile+"variabile sommatoria")
}
function conguaglio(){
var quota=0;
s_giorni_uso = sommatoria(giorni_uso);
console.log(s_giorni_uso +" giorni in cui il furgone è stato usato");
giorni_comuni= 365-s_giorni_uso;
console.log(giorni_comuni+ " giorni di inutilizzo")
q_giorni_comuni=p_giornaliero*giorni_comuni;
console.log(q_giorni_comuni+ "quota per i giorni di inutilizzo")
for(var i=0;i<user.length;i=i+1){
quota=(giorni_uso[i]*full_giornaliero)+q_giorni_comuni;
console.log("quota "+ user[i]+" (giorni "+giorni_uso[i]+"): "+quota)
quote.push(quota);
}
}
conguaglio();
function message(div,msg){
$(div).html(msg);
};
//console.log(quote)
// sommatoria(quote)
$(function(){
$( "#setname" ).on( "click", function( event ) {
// Prevent the usual navigation behavior
event.preventDefault();
setpropname();
$(`#popup1`).popup(`close`);
});
});
function setpropname(){
prog_name.push($(`#p-name`).prop(`value`));
console.log(prog_name[0]);
message(`#prog-name`,prog_name[0]);
};
$( "#setname" ).on( "click", function( event ) {
// Prevent the usual navigation behavior
event.preventDefault();
setpropname();
});